[PATCH] arm64: dts: renesas: salvator-common: Remove extra LVDS port label

2017-07-13 Thread Laurent Pinchart
The DU LVDS output is on port 3 on R8A7795 but on port 2 on R8A7796. The lvds_connector label thus can't be defined in salvator-common.dtsi, common to the two SoCs. The lvds_connector label is meant for convience to be referenced from panel device tree files, such as r8a77xx-aa104xd12-panel.dtsi o
